Policy, ownership and the paper trail
Security is a named responsibility with a named owner, not a shared intention. Policies are written, approved, versioned and reviewed on a cycle - and the audit that renews the certificate checks that the cycle actually ran.
- Documented ISMS with a Statement of Applicability covering every Annex A control we apply - and a recorded justification for any we don't
- Risk register maintained continuously, with treatment plans and residual risk accepted at a named level
- Supplier and sub-processor review before any third party touches a client environment
- Incident response with defined severities, escalation paths and client notification obligations
